The purpose of this research is to determine the effect of job stress and workload to job satisfaction of employees of PT. Thamrin Brother's Lahat. The research sample included 30 employees of PT. Thamrin Brother's Lahat. Test instrument test in this study are validity and reliability test for questionaure. Test requirements analysis include: data normality test, the linearity of the data, multiple linear regression, t test, F test and determination coefficient. The result of this research give the regression model . Based on the results of SPSS, value of correlation  (r) is 0.839, it can be concluded that the variable work stress and workload variables have a very strong relationship to employee job satisfaction variable PT. Thamrin Brother's Lahat. The value of coefficient of determination (R2) is 0,704. This means that the influence of employee job satisfaction variable PT. Thamrin Brother's Lahat can be explained by work stress and workload variable with contribution of 70,4%, while the rest of 29,6% can be explained by other variable not included in this research model. Partial t-test show result that job stress and woakload both has the positive significant influence to job satisfaction. Simultant test with F-test show that job stress and workload as a whole have a significant effect on employee work satisfaction PT. Thamrin Brother's Lahat.

The purpose of this study to determine and analyze the influence of job stress and job satisfaction partially and simultaneously to the performance of employees of PT. Primatama Mulia Jaya IV Koto Kecamatan Kinali Kab. Pasaman Barat. The research method used is quantitative descriptive. The sampling technique used is accidental sampling method so that from the population is taken as many as 73 respondents, the data collection method used is by using survey or observation, questionnaire and literature study. Data analysis techniques used were classical assumptions, multiple linear regression, t test, F test and detemination coefficients. Based on multiple regression analysis, work stress variable and job satisfaction on employee performance in get Y = 18,776 + 0,510 X1 + 0,156 X2 + e. From the t test conducted got job stress and job satisfaction have a significant and positive effect on employee performance of PT. Primatama Mulia Jaya IV Koto Kecamatan Kinali Kab. Pasaman Barat From the results of F test proved that the variable of work stress and job satisfaction simultaneously have a significant and positive effect on the performance of employees of PT. Primatama Mulia Jaya IV Koto Kecamatan Kinali Kab. Pasaman Barat, while the result of coefficient of determination obtained ability of independent variable explain dependent variable equal to 36,9% rest 63,1% explained by other variable not used in this research.

The problem in this study is how the effect of work conflict, work environment and work stress on employee job satisfaction at the Representative Office of the Population and Family Planning Agency (BKKBN) North Sumatra. This study aims to determine partially the variables of work conflict, work environment and work stress affect employee job satisfaction and the effect of work conflict, work environment, and job stress simultaneously on employee job satisfaction. associative and quantitative. The sampling technique used a saturated sample to 84 permanent employees. The data collection technique used interviews, documentation studies and questionnaires. The data analysis technique of this research uses classical assumption test and multiple linear regression analysis. Data processing in this study used statistical software SPPS 20. The results showed that based on the results of the t test, the conflict variable partially had a negative and insignificant effect on job satisfaction. The work environment variable partially has a positive and significant effect on employee job satisfaction. Job stress variable has a positive and insignificant effect on employee job satisfaction. In the results of the f test in this study, simultaneously the variables of work conflict, work environment and work stress have an effect on employee job satisfaction. Abstract  –  Compensation is one of the important parts in an effort to meet job satisfaction for employees in an organization. With high job satisfaction employees are expected to feel happy at work, more motivated in work, increased productivity, and make employees become more loyal to the organization. This study aims to determine the effect of compensation on employee job satisfaction at PT Kereta Api Indonesia (Persero) Operational Area 1 Jakarta. The study was conducted by dividing the questionnaire to a number of 35 people, all employees of the general section and HR who were used as research samples. Data analysis using simple regression analysis, correlation coefficient, and coefficient of determination. The results of the study indicate a positive and direct effect between compensation for employee job satisfaction. Based on the calculation of the correlation coefficient obtained a result of 0.723 where the number of scores shows the strong relationship of compensation to employee job satisfaction. From the calculation of the coefficient of determination, it can be seen that compensation affects employee job satisfaction by 52.3% while the remaining 47.7% is influenced by other factors beyond research. Key Word: Financial compensation, non financial compensation,  Job Satisfaction

Companies must be able to maintain employee performance to remain stable and even increase. Satisfied employees are effective and well-performing workers. The purpose of this study was to determine the direct effect of work stress and job satisfaction on employee performance, to determine work stress on employee job satisfaction, and to determine the effect of Job Satisfaction in mediating the effect of work stress on employee performance. The population in this study were 47 Fave Hotel Housekeeping Department employees. Sampling uses a saturated sample technique and the data was analyzed using path analysis techniques. The results showed that work stress has a negative and significant effect on job satisfaction and employee performance, namely the higher the level of work stress that employees have, the lower the job satisfaction and employee performance that will be formed within the employee. Job satisfaction has a positive and significant effect on employee performance. This means that the higher job satisfaction felt by employees, the higher the performance of employees that will be formed. Job satisfaction is positively and significantly mediates the effect of work stress on employee performance. Keywords: Job Satisfaction, Job Stress, and Employee Performance

The purpose of this study is to determine the effect of work stress on employee voluntary turnover intention, with the dimensions of work stress partially and simultaneously. The use of methods in this study is to use the type of sampling included in Simple Random Sampling and by distributing questionnaires as many as 210 respondents. The data analysis technique method used is Path Analysis by using SPSS 24 Software, and for hypothesis testing is a partial statistical test (t test) and a simultaneous test (f test). The results, the t test showed that work stress through the Role Conflict dimension (X1) had a positive and not significant effect on Voluntary Turnover Intention, the Ambiguous / Unclear Role (X2) had a positive and significant effect on Voluntary Turnover Intention, Excessive Workload (X3 ) has a positive and significant effect on Voluntary Turnover Intention. Based on the F test sig value 0,000 <0,05 which means that work stress together (simultaneous) namely Role Conflict (X1), ambiguous / unclear role (X2), and excessive workload (X3) have a significant effect towards Voluntary Turnover Intention (Y). Conclusion, simultaneously job stress has a positive and significant effect on employee voluntary turnover intention at PT Doosan Sinar Sukabumi, Sukabumi Regency Keywords: Job Stress, Voluntary Turnover Intention

This research was conducted at Quality Control Division of PT X Padalarang, aimed to determine correlation leadership and job satisfaction, and also to analyze the effect of leadership on job satisfaction at Quality Control Division of PT X Padalarang. Respondents of this research are 52 people selected with simple random sampling technique. The method used is descriptive and associative, which tests the connection using the Spearman rank correlation analysis, and also done to determine the accuracy of measurement using by the   validity and reliability test. Results of the validity and reliability test of variables X and Y are valid and reliable. Calculations were performed using SPSS software ver. 19. The result of this study showed that leadership is in the category of good and job satisfaction is in the category of good. Results showed the correlation of leadership with job satisfaction at Quality Control Division of PT X Padalarang with correlation coefficient = 0,679. Based on the criteria champion, this relationship is in the criteria of strong relationship. Results of this calculation showed the coefficient of determination = 46, 10%. It showed that the hypothesis is proved, that there is an influence of leadership to job satisfaction at Quality Control Division of PT X Padalarang.

Abstract One way to improve the performance of the HR is to pay attention to employee satisfaction. Job satisfaction is an important factor in HR to produce the optimal performance. If this employee fells dissatisfaction, it can cause work stress and make employees leave the company. Therefore, social support is needed to manage the level of stress from work in company environment.This research was held in PT. Charoen Pokphand Jaya Farm to find out wether there is an influence betwee job stress to job satisfaction wit a source of social support as a moderating variable. The sample of tis study was 40 hatchery employees, and using a censuss method. Researchers analyzed and calculated with regression.The result of tis study refer to the formulated hypothesis that job stress has a negative effect on job satisfaction, and social support can reduce job stress and social support has a positive influence to job satisfaction of employees. On the analysis result which used t-test showed that job stress and the interaction between job stress and social support has a influence to job satisfaction.   Keyword : Job Stress, Social Support, Job Satisfaction.

This study aims to analyze the effect of job stress and job satisfaction on the psychological well-being of postgraduate employees at the State Islamic University of Sunan Ampel Surabaya. This research method uses quantitative research, with the method used in sampling is saturated sampling. The population used is 41 employees. The analysis of this study using Multiple Linear Regression Analysis by IBM SPSS Statistics 24.0 software. This study concluded that job stress has a negative and meaningful effect on psychological well-being because the burden of many tasks results in stress that causes psychological well-being to decrease. For job satisfaction has a positive and meaningful effect on psychological well-being, the lack of employees results in dissatisfaction when doing work that affects psychological well-being. Meanwhile, the meaningful effect of job stress and job satisfaction on psychological well-being occurs because the simultaneous significance test (f test) are overall Ho is accepted. Institutions must pay attention to work stress experienced by their employees so that the psychological well-being of employees can be well maintained and will have a good impact on employee job satisfaction.
